A classic which should be on every bookshelf, ' - Scotland on Sunday Glasgow, ?the dear green placeOCO, is the setting for Archie HindOCOs acclaimed novel. Mat Craig is a young Glaswegian working-class hero and would-be novelist, whose desire to define himself as an artist creates social and family tensions. Set in 1960s Glasgow, The Dear Green Place is an absorbing and moving story, the whole book is invested with strong and sombre descriptions of the city around Mat."
